Common Signs Your Deck Needs Attention

Knowing when to conduct deck repair is vital for preserving your space. Look for signs like splintering wood, visible mold, or rusted nails. These indicate underlying issues that require immediate action. Addressing them promptly prevents further deterioration. Additionally, any movement or sagging suggests potential structural instability needing professional evaluation. Ignoring these signals can lead to more extensive repairs down the line.

Step-by-Step Guide to Basic Deck Maintenance

  • Clean regularly: Sweep debris and wash surfaces with mild soap and water.
  • Inspect annually: Check for loose boards, protruding nails, or areas of decay.
  • Seal and stain: Apply protective finishes every few years to shield against moisture.
  • Repair promptly: Fix minor damages quickly to prevent escalation.
  • Consult professionals: Seek expert advice when facing complex issues.

Expert Tips for Long-Term Preservation

Experts recommend several strategies for long-term deck preservation. First, use quality materials during construction or repairs to withstand environmental stressors. Second, ensure proper drainage around your deck to avoid water accumulation which causes wood rot. Lastly, consider seasonal treatments like sealing before winter or cleaning after fall leaves accumulate. Adhering to these practices significantly prolongs the usefulness of your deck.
